Your release feed

The Needle / Botswana - Current

description is not available.

Description is not available.

"The Needle / Botswana - Current" is a mix of vibrant beats, introspective lyrics, and high-energy tracks that reflect a dynamic blend of genres. From the pulsating rhythms of Vetkuk and Mahoota’s "Bula Nthweo" to the smooth production of DJ Zinhle and Basetsana’s "Mdali," this playlist highlights music that is making waves. Hip-hop and trap influences come through with tracks like Desiigner’s "Drip Check" and G Herbo’s "Subject," while amapiano and Afrobeat sounds shine in selections like DJ Melzi and Senzo Afrika’s "Ngalo Tshwala."

There’s also space for melodic storytelling and reflective moments, such as WHATUPRG’s "This Time Last Year" and Willow’s "b i g f e e l i n g s." The inclusion of diverse artists like Dolly Parton with "Southern Accents" and ZAYN’s "Alienated" adds an unexpected but welcome variety. Whether it’s for a high-energy session or a relaxed vibe, this playlist curates a snapshot of current sounds that are resonating across different musical landscapes.

LeeMcKrazy 3 tracks
DJ Maphorisa 2 tracks
Xduppy 2 tracks
Mellow & Sleazy 2 tracks
CowBoii 2 tracks
Nile Rodgers 2 tracks
Related Playlists
The Needle / Zimbabwe 74 shared artists
The Needle / Zimbabwe - Current 56 shared artists
The Needle / Malawi 51 shared artists
The Needle / Kenya 43 shared artists
The Needle / Mozambique 41 shared artists
The Needle / Kenya - Current 39 shared artists

RecentMusic users are tracking 190 The Needle / Botswana - Current artists for new releases, and have access to the full timeline of 6,167 releases .

Join them and feed your new music addiction, and add the The Needle / Botswana - Current artists you love!

Get Started Browse Artists
  1. August 1, 2025
  2. August 1
  3. August 1
  4. August 1
  5. July 31
  6. July 29
  7. July 25
  8. July 25
  9. July 25
  10. July 25
  11. July 23
  12. July 22
  13. July 18
  14. July 18
  15. July 18
  16. July 18
  17. July 18
  18. July 18
  19. July 16
  20. July 11
  21. July 11
  22. July 11
  23. July 11
  24. July 11
  25. July 11
  26. July 11
  27. July 11
  28. July 4
  29. July 4
  30. July 4
  31. July 4
  32. July 4
  33. July 4
  34. July 4
  35. June 30
  36. June 27
  37. June 27
  38. June 27
  39. June 27
  40. June 27